Vandals of Armenian cemeteries identified in Russia

The Russian police have identified and arrested the vandals having destroyed Armenian and Russian cemeteries  in the Russian city of Novorosiysk, according to weekly Yerkramas, published by the Armenian community in Russia. According to the source, the vandals have been unveiled due to the operative-investigative activities of special groups.

According to the information, a suspect pleaded guilty, pointing his criminal accessories. No other details have been reported.

Note that 3 cemeteries were rampaged in Novorosiysk, Russia, in the night from July 23 to July 24, destroying 44 Armenian and Russian gravestones. Armenian Embassy in Russia had addressed a note of complaint to Russian Foreign Ministry over the incident.
